Sleep and pants are a recurring problem in GAL.
After 20 years of medicine, my advice, get a sleep study.[/quote]
I got inconclusive results from a sleep study, but even that was valuable.
It was good to know that I DIDN’T have apnea, restless legs, mild narcolepsy, etc. My sleep efficiency wasn’t so high, but it helped knowing it wasn’t from some common major issue.
